Ex-Bayern star Görlitz trains TSV Rott: Comeback at home!

The football scene in Bavaria is talking about: Andreas Görlitz, former professional of FC Bayern Munich, returns to TSV Rott as a coach. Where his football journey began almost 30 years ago, he takes over the scepter on the sidelines. This reports t-online .

From the beginning to the coaching bench - Görlitz ’path is impressive. He started at his home club TSV Rott/Lech at the age of just seven. In his youth he went through the stations that later led him to top -class clubs such as 1860 Munich and FC Bayern. For a transfer fee of 2.5 million euros, he switched to FC Bayern in 2004, where he played 26 games and also drew attention internationally in the Champions League. After a career that ended in 2015, Görlitz turned to music and founded the band "Whale City".

a new era for TSV Rott

In the coming season, TSV Rott will play in the A-Class Group 8 of the Upper Bavaria district of Zugspitze. Here opponents like SV Wessobrunn-Haid and TSV Burgen/Bernbeuren II are waiting for the team. But the past season was anything but simple: the TSV missed the promotion in the relegation. The return of Görlitz should bring fresh wind into the team. TSV soccer director Michael Welzmiller is optimistic and hopes for a clear thrust for the players.

Görlitz is full of zest for action and would like to get to know the players better at first. "The fun of football is important to me," he emphasizes. In order to prepare the team in the best possible way, he plans to improve the conditional foundations by playing forms instead of relying on traditional training methods. This approach could help the team to make the next season more successful.

a life between football and music

It is remarkable how Görlitz was involved in the music scene after his active career. His passion for music initially led him to the rock band "Room77" and later to the foundation of "Whale City", where he performed as a singer. This artistic streak seems to have harmonized well with its sporting career and shows that it is versatile in life.
